The dewatering screen is an essential part of modern sand, gravel, and mineral processing lines. It uses high-frequency vibration to separate water from fine materials, reducing moisture content and improving product quality. The screen is widely used in mining, quarrying, and construction projects to enhance operational efficiency and material handling.
I. High-Efficiency Dewatering
Equipped with a multi-layer screen deck and high-frequency vibration system, the dewatering screen can remove up to 90% of free water from sand or aggregates. This significantly reduces drying time, improves bulk density, and ensures compliance with project specifications for moisture content.
II. Durable and Reliable Construction
The machine is built with high-strength steel and wear-resistant mesh screens to handle abrasive materials such as river sand, gravel, and industrial ores. Bearings, vibration motors, and support structures are engineered for long-term durability under continuous operation, minimizing downtime and maintenance costs.
III. Precise Material Separation
The dewatering screen separates materials not only by moisture content but also by particle size. Adjustable vibration frequency and deck slope allow operators to achieve precise separation according to project requirements, producing consistent, high-quality sand and aggregate for concrete or industrial use.
IV. On-Site Flexibility and Integration
Compact and modular in design, the dewatering screen can be easily integrated into existing crushing, screening, and washing lines. Its mobility allows on-site relocation, while conveyors and water collection systems optimize material flow and water recycling, increasing operational efficiency.
